The Ultimate Guide to a Bouldering Birthday PartyPlanning a birthday party that balances high energy, safety, and universal fun can feel like a steep climb. Traditional venues like bowling alleys or trampoline parks are classic options, but a growing trend is taking celebrations to new heights. Bouldering, which is rock climbing stripped down to its purest form without ropes or harnesses, offers an exhilarating alternative. A bouldering birthday party provides an active, engaging, and memorable experience for participants of almost any age or fitness level.Unlike traditional top-rope climbing, which requires complex knots, heavy gear, and constant belaying, bouldering keeps things simple. Climbers scale shorter walls, typically under fifteen feet, positioned over thick, heavily padded safety mats. This minimalist approach removes the technical barriers to entry, making it an ideal group activity. Guests can walk right up to the wall and start climbing within minutes of arriving at the facility.

Why Bouldering Works for All AgesOne of the greatest advantages of bouldering is its inherent inclusivity. Climbing gyms design their walls with a wide variety of routes, universally known as problems. These routes are color-coded by difficulty, ranging from ladder-like ascents for absolute beginners to complex, gravity-defying sequences for experts. This means that a group of seven-year-olds, a pack of teenagers, or an adventurous gathering of adults can all find appropriate challenges side by side.Bouldering is also naturally social. Because there are no ropes or long waiting lines for a belayer, multiple participants can climb simultaneously on different sections of the wall. When they are not on the mats, guests stand together on the safety flooring, cheering each other on, sharing advice, and celebrating successful ascents. The environment fosters spontaneous teamwork and camaraderie, turning an individual sport into a highly interactive group celebration.

Setting Up for SuccessOrganizing a bouldering birthday requires very little preparation from the host, as modern climbing gyms are highly optimized for events. Most facilities offer dedicated birthday packages that include a private party room, dedicated staff members to coach the guests, and rental shoes for all participants. When booking, it is beneficial to schedule a brief orientation session at the start of the event to ensure everyone understands gym safety etiquette.The role of the gym staff is crucial for a smooth experience. Instructors guide the party guests through a fun warm-up, demonstrate proper falling techniques onto the plush mats, and offer helpful tips on how to use footwork rather than raw upper-body strength. Having professional staff manage the floor allows the host to relax, take photographs, and socialize with parents rather than managing a chaotic crowd of energetic children or guests.

Games and Challenges on the WallTo keep the momentum going during a two-hour party, incorporating simple climbing games can elevate the excitement. A popular choice is Add-On, where the first climber chooses a starting hold, the second climber must use that hold and add a new one, and the sequence builds progressively with each participant. This game exercises both the body and the memory, keeping everyone engaged in the action.Another excellent activity for a birthday group is a low-stakes scavenger hunt. Gym staff or hosts can tape small markers or small prize tokens next to specific holds on beginner routes. Guests then climb to retrieve them, which shifts the focus away from the fear of heights and onto a fun, tangible objective. For older groups, a friendly speed competition on a designated easy route can provide a thrilling finale to the active portion of the event.

Fueling the ClimbersClimbing uses practically every muscle group, meaning that party guests will work up a significant appetite. Transitioning from the climbing floor to the party room for food and cake is a welcome break. High-carbohydrate and protein-rich snacks like pizza, fruit skewers, and sandwiches are ideal for replenishing energy levels after an hour of intense physical activity.When it comes to party favors, hosts can easily stay on theme. Custom chalk bags, reusable water bottles, or healthy energy bars make excellent alternatives to standard plastic trinkets. Many gyms also include a complimentary pass for a future visit in their party packages, giving the guest of honor and their friends a perfect excuse to return to the sport.

A Memorable New TraditionChoosing a bouldering theme transforms a standard birthday party into a shared adventure. It provides a healthy, screen-free environment where guests can challenge themselves physically and mentally. The sense of accomplishment a child or adult feels when finally reaching the top of a difficult route is unmatched. By introducing friends to the joy of climbing, a bouldering birthday celebration creates lasting memories and might even spark a lifelong passion for a rewarding new sport.
